KiCad PCB EDA Suite
Loading...
Searching...
No Matches
SPICE_SIMULATOR Member List

This is the complete list of members for SPICE_SIMULATOR, including all inherited members.

AllVectors() const =0SPICE_SIMULATORpure virtual
Attach(const std::shared_ptr< SIMULATION_MODEL > &aModel, const wxString &aSimCommand, unsigned aSimOptions, REPORTER &aReporter)SIMULATORinlinevirtual
Clean()=0SIMULATORpure virtual
Command(const std::string &aCmd)=0SPICE_SIMULATORpure virtual
CreateInstance(const std::string &aName)SIMULATORstatic
CurrentPlotName() const =0SPICE_SIMULATORpure virtual
GetComplexVector(const std::string &aName, int aMaxLen=-1)=0SPICE_SIMULATORpure virtual
GetGainVector(const std::string &aName, int aMaxLen=-1)=0SPICE_SIMULATORpure virtual
GetImaginaryVector(const std::string &aName, int aMaxLen=-1)=0SPICE_SIMULATORpure virtual
GetMutex()SIMULATORinline
GetNetlist() const =0SPICE_SIMULATORpure virtual
GetPhaseVector(const std::string &aName, int aMaxLen=-1)=0SPICE_SIMULATORpure virtual
GetRealVector(const std::string &aName, int aMaxLen=-1)=0SPICE_SIMULATORpure virtual
GetSettingCommands() const =0SPICE_SIMULATORpure virtual
GetXAxis(SIM_TYPE aType) const =0SPICE_SIMULATORpure virtual
Init(const SPICE_SETTINGS *aSettings=nullptr)=0SPICE_SIMULATORpure virtual
IsRunning()=0SIMULATORpure virtual
LoadNetlist(const std::string &aNetlist)=0SPICE_SIMULATORpure virtual
m_mutexSIMULATORprivate
m_reporterSPICE_SIMULATORprotected
m_settingsSPICE_SIMULATORprotected
m_simModelSIMULATORprotected
Run()=0SIMULATORpure virtual
SetReporter(SIMULATOR_REPORTER *aReporter)SPICE_SIMULATORinlinevirtual
Settings()SPICE_SIMULATORinline
Settings() constSPICE_SIMULATORinline
SIMULATOR()SIMULATORinline
SPICE_SIMULATOR()SPICE_SIMULATORinline
Stop()=0SIMULATORpure virtual
TypeToName(SIM_TYPE aType, bool aShortName)SPICE_SIMULATORstatic
~SIMULATOR()SIMULATORinlinevirtual
~SPICE_SIMULATOR()SPICE_SIMULATORinlinevirtual